Objectives:
- To
measure the amount of lead in soil in the El Paso-Juarez region
so that the community may know of areas where children might
be at risk of exposure.
- To
identify indoor sources and amount of lead in selected households
in El Paso and Cd. Juarez.
- To
measure the amount of lead in the blood of selected children
so that researchers can estimate recent exposure to lead in
El Paso and Cd. Juarez.
- To
measure the amount of lead stored in the bone of selected children
so that researchers can also estimate long-term exposure to
lead.
- To
include the binational community through involvement of community-based
organizations, students, parents, health and environmental agencies,
and others.
- To
facilitate the use of the results by the community for the direct
benefit of the binational community.
- To
promote the capacity of health care providers, parents, and
community groups to address environmental health issues through
skill-building, education, and scientific learning.
